Reconcile puzzle

I am seeing strange behavior that I've never observed in 30 years of using Quicken.
When I try to reconcile my Sam's Club World Mastercard account, there is an entry in the register that does not show up in the reconcile window, and the account balance is off by the amount of that transaction. I have attached screen shots of the register and the reconcile window. The transaction is Cleared but not Reconciled, and should be shown as a debit in the reconcile window. Anyone have any idea what is going on here?

    Turn on Downloaded posting date column.  I think you will find that the posting date for that transaction is past the reconcile ending date.  When available Quicken uses the downloaded posting date for determining if a transaction should be included in the reconcile, not the date the user has entered.

    BTW I thought this afterwards.  If you right click on the transaction it will give a menu and you can select Copy, and then right click again to paste it.  That will give you a transaction that is identical, but without the posting date.

    Note that the rules are use the posting date if available, if not use the one entered by the user (the main date).  And of course a "non downloaded" transaction doesn't have a posting date.
